- Governor Beebe Authorizes Emergency Leave For State Employees Impoacted By Storms
LITTLE ROCK - Governor Mike Beebe has signed an executive order granting up to a week of paid emergency leave for Arkansas state employees who suffered substantial damage during the tornadoes and thunderstorms of February 5.

- Governor Beebe Declares Three Additional Counties Disaster Areas Due To Last Week's Storms
LITTLE ROCK - Governor Mike Beebe has added Franklin, Marion and Newton Counties to the list of state disaster areas due to the damage caused by powerful tornadoes and violent thunderstorms on Tuesday, February 5, taking the total to 13 counties. Beebe previously made declarations for Baxter, Conway, Independence, Izard, Pope, Randolph, Sharp, Stone, Union and Van Buren Counties.

- Health Department Update on Tuberculosis and Hansen's Disease
(Little Rock) The Arkansas Department of Health (ADH) is receiving reports from concerned citizens about a possible outbreak of 300 plus cases of tuberculosis (Tb) and an outbreak of Hansen's Disease (leprosy) in Benton, Washington and Sebastian counties). There are no outbreaks of either disease in the state.

- Governor Beebe Declares Ten Counties Disaster Areas Due To Tornado And Thunderstorm Damage
LITTLE ROCK - Governor Mike Beebe has declared Baxter, Conway, Independence, Izard, Pope, Randolph, Sharp, Stone, Union and Van Buren Counties state disaster areas due to the damage caused by powerful tornadoes and violent thunderstorms on Tuesday, February 5. - Governor Beebe Names Arkansas HIV/AIDS Minority Taskforce Members
LITTLE ROCK - Governor Mike Beebe today announced 19 appointments to the new Arkansas HIV/AIDS Minority Taskforce. Created by Act 842 of the 86th General Assembly, the Taskforce will study how to improve prevention and treatment of HIV and AIDS in Arkansas's minority communities.
